I’m an Integrative Child & Adolescent Psychotherapist and Counsellor, based in St Albans, Hertfordshire. I am a clinical member of the UKCP (UK Council for Psychotherapy, College for Child and Adolescent Psychotherapies, CCAP) and a registered member of the BACP (British Association for Counselling and Psychotherapy. I trained at the Institute for Arts in Therapy and Education (IATE), where I learnt from leading experts in Child and Adolescent Psychotherapy, such as Graham Music and Dan Hughes (PACE), amongst others.

My training and clinical practice are grounded in psychoanalytic, attachment-based, and arts-informed approaches. I draw on creative arts and play as powerful ways for children and young people to express their inner world, particularly when words alone are not enough. I take care to adapt the work to suit the developmental stage, emotional needs and unique way of communicating of every child or adolescent I work with.

At the heart of my work is building a safe and trusting therapeutic relationship, where thoughts and feelings can be explored at a pace that feels right.

Children and teenagers come to counselling or therapy for many different reasons: struggles with friendships, low mood, anxiety, angry outbursts, or school-related issues. Others may be experiencing the impact of trauma, bereavement, family breakdown, or neurodiverse differences. Sometimes the reasons aren’t clear, but a child may seem persistently unhappy, withdrawn, or overwhelmed.

I aim to support my clients in developing the emotional resilience and inner resources they need, not only to cope with current challenges, but also to build a stronger foundation for their lives ahead.
